The Riddler
The Riddler (Edward Nigma, later Edward Nygma or Edward Nashton) is a supervillain appearing in American comic books published by DC Comics. The character was created by Bill Finger and Dick Sprang, and debuted in Detective Comics #140 in October 1948.

Why does Barry Keoghan Joker look like that?

According to director Matt Reeves, he was born that way. "It's like Phantom of the Opera," Reeves explained to Variety. "He has a congenital disease where he can't stop smiling and it's horrific. His face is half-covered through most of the film." This adds a new dimension to the character of The Joker.

Why did the Riddler cry at the end?

Batman goes to Arkham and confronts him, but the Riddler tells him that he believes they've been working together to rid Gotham of corruption. Heartbroken that Batman isn't on his side, Riddler cries that this wasn't how it was meant to go and they were supposed to be "safe" in Arkham together.

Who was the Robin that Joker tortured?

Jason Todd was a street orphan until he met Batman after he had saved him from The Joker. Jason was trained by Batman and later became the second Robin, but he was beaten and tortured by the Joker, who sent Batman a video of the event and lied by telling him that Jason was dead.

What was Arthur Fleck diagnosed with in Joker?

The psychopathology Arthur exhibits is unclear, preventing diagnosis of psychotic disorder or schizophrenia; the unusual combination of symptoms suggests a complex mix of features of certain personality traits, namely psychopathy and narcissism (he meets DSM-5 criteria for narcissistic personality disorder).
